Introduction
This chart bootstraps a Hazelcast and Management Center deployments on a Kubernetes cluster using the Helm package manager.
Prerequisites
- Kubernetes 1.9+
Installing the Chart
To install the chart with the release name my-release:
$ helm install --name my-release stable/hazelcast
The command deploys Hazelcast on the Kubernetes cluster in the default configuration. The configuration section lists the parameters that can be configured during installation.

Uninstalling the Chart
To uninstall/delete the my-release deployment:
$ helm delete my-release
The command removes all the Kubernetes components associated with the chart and deletes the release.

Specify each parameter using the --set key=value[,key=value] argument to helm install. For example,
$ helm install --name my-release \
--set cluster.memberCount=3,hazelcast.rest=false \
stable/hazelcast
The above command sets number of Hazelcast members to 3 and disables REST endpoints.
Alternatively, a YAML file that specifies the values for the parameters can be provided while installing the chart. For example,
$ helm install --name my-release -f values.yaml stable/hazelcast

Custom Hazelcast configuration
Custom Hazelcast configuration can be specified inside values.yaml, as the hazelcast.yaml property.
hazelcast:
yaml:
hazelcast:
network:
join:
multicast:
enabled: false
kubernetes:
enabled: true
service-name: ${serviceName}
namespace: ${namespace}
resolve-not-ready-addresses: true
